Abstract

In India, pearl millet blast caused by Magnaporthe grisea is becoming a serious problem and causes
significant yield losses in various parts of country. In this study, we have standardized phenotyping
procedure against pearl millet blast disease. Further, we have evaluated 15 inbred lines in which
three entries were highly resistant viz., PPMI 1087, PPMI 1089 and PPMI 660 and two entries
(PPMI 1084 and J 108) were identified as resistant. This method will be useful for large scale
screening of pearl millet entries against blast pathogen.
